<h3>Why even small, resource-constrained nonprofits should be using social media</h3>
<p>Guest post by<strong> Jordan Viator</strong><br />
<a href="http://www.convio.com/signup/nonprofit-live-tv.html">Nonprofit Live TV</a></p>
<p><span class="dropcap">W</span>hat are some of the ways in which social media can be used to advance the social good? Nonprofit Live TV put the question to <a href="http://twitter.com/MatthewMahan">Matt Mahan</a>, Nonprofit and Business Development Director of <a href="http://www.causes.com/">Causes</a> and <a href="http://twitter.com/Cariegrls">Carie Lewis</a>, Director of Emerging Media of the <a href="http://www.humanesociety.org">Humane Society of the United States</a>.</p>
<p>The 7-minute interview, conducted at the 2009 Convio Summit conference for nonprofits in Austin, Texas, last month, addresses how smaller, resource-constrained nonprofits can be using social media. </p>
<p>Mahan and Lewis give examples of how outreach on Twitter or Facebook can engage support for a cause or organization. When someone&#8217;s birthday rolls around, Mahan says, instead of giving them a Starbucks gift certificate or the like, It&#8217;s much more meaningful to receive a gift in the name of someone who&#8217;s truly deserving. The Causes site has also recently upgraded its partner center to enable nonprofits to interact more actively with their supporters on Facebook.<span id="more-3698"></span></p>
